The M-260E Deluxe offers upgraded appointments and features to the “M” concert-sized acoustics in Guild’s 200 series lineup. Taking after the flagship USA made M-20, the M-260E carries the same reduced body dimensions and shorter scale length that have made Guild "M" models the choice of many players over the brand’s 70-year history. Thanks to its archback design, this acoustic delivers a powerful voice with its small body and is perfect for fingerstyle playing and light strumming.  

Archback – Guild was the first guitar manufacturer to introduce back arching on flat top acoustic instruments and this defining build technique sets Guild guitars apart. An archback creates: 

  • Tone Projection – a deeper and contoured body chamber that increases projection 
  • Weight Reduction – no back bracing which reduces weight and improves resonance  
  • Strength – arching creates structure and strength, adding durability. Made to be Played. 

“M” Concert Body Shape – First introduced in 1957 on the M-20, Guild’s M Concert body shape has stood the test of time for nearly 70 years. This acoustic shape is comfortable for smaller players, makes for a great songwriting companion and is ideal for fingerstyle playing and light strumming. 

Exotic Woods – Solid Spruce top with Striped Ebony back and sides. Striped Ebony has an exotic look with an intricate grain pattern reminiscent of Rosewood, but slightly darker with complimentary brown striping. 

200 “Deluxe” Trim Level – Stepping up from our standard 200 series, the Deluxe trim package includes a bound fingerboard, gloss body with satin neck, additional body purfling inlay, Mother-of-Pearl headstock and rosette inlay, and Guild Vintage 18 Open Gear tuning machines with 18:1 gear ratio. 

Additional Premium Materials – Real bone nut and saddle and Rosewood fingerboard  

Fishman x Guild GT-1 Pickup System – Featuring a Fishman S-Core piezo and internal soundhole mounted volume and tone controls for ease of use and no drilling or impact on the acoustic body design.
